Live on

A flag raised high fluttering in the wind calls

And begs that some defend its colors

Far from the theaters and shopping malls

Men and women support each other


And the heat of desert sand or jungle rain

Stinging the souls of those who answered

So many would run, but our heroes remain

Enemies jeering, our soldiers undeterred


Explosions and bullets a tornado of death

Seeking to extinguish the fire in our lives

That monster of war stole some of their breath

Some of our heroes sacrificed and died


Yet they live in our hearts and in our minds

We cannot forget that they lived for us

Never let go of the love that binds

Though all flesh melts, bones turn to dust
